Reflecting on the eerie encounter, the narrative shifts to an exploration of the Ghost Rider’s origins and legacy within the Marvel Universe. From the iconic character of Johnny Blaze to the diverse incarnations that have carried the mantle of Ghost Rider, each iteration brings a unique perspective to the timeless tale of vengeance and redemption.

Delving into the historical context of Ghost Rider’s lore, the article traces the character’s evolution from a stunt cyclist entwined with demonic forces to a spectral avenger bound by a pact with the infernal realms. The intricate web of deals, sacrifices, and supernatural elements that define Ghost Rider’s existence adds depth to the character’s enduring appeal.

Proposing a cinematic vision for a new Ghost Rider film, the article envisions a fusion of Western and horror genres that captures the essence of the character’s dual nature. Drawing inspiration from iconic works that blend elements of the supernatural with themes of guilt, redemption, and retribution, the proposed film seeks to carve a unique narrative path within the Marvel Cinematic Universe.

Emphasizing the need for a visionary director to helm the project, the article suggests potential candidates such as Mike Flanagan, James Wan, or Guillermo Del Toro to bring Ghost Rider’s dark and atmospheric world to life on the big screen. The thematic richness of Ghost Rider’s story, intertwined with themes of duality and moral ambiguity, offers a compelling canvas for cinematic exploration.

With the prospect of introducing Ghost Rider into the Marvel Cinematic Universe, the article underscores the character’s potential to add a new dimension to the supernatural landscape of the MCU. By weaving elements of American folklore, Southern Gothic aesthetics, and post-Blip societal dynamics, a Ghost Rider film could delve into uncharted territories of darkness and redemption.

As the narrative unfolds, the article envisions a Ghost Rider film that transcends traditional superhero tropes, embracing a narrative that delves into the complexities of guilt, justice, and the eternal struggle between light and darkness. With the promise of bone-chilling terror and moral introspection, Ghost Rider stands poised to make a haunting entry into the ever-expanding tapestry of the Marvel Cinematic Universe.
